How they compare

Saint Vincent and the Grenadines currently reports 17.3% against 17.0% in Costa Rica, a difference of 0.3%.

Across all 74 years both countries report, Saint Vincent and the Grenadines has been ahead every year.

Costa Rica ranks 97th and Saint Vincent and the Grenadines ranks 95th of 236 countries.

Saint Vincent and the Grenadines has averaged higher in every one of the 8 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Costa Rica Saint Vincent and the Grenadines Difference Ahead
1950s 6.1% 11.5% 5.4% Saint Vincent and the Grenadines
1960s 6.1% 8.5% 2.4% Saint Vincent and the Grenadines
1970s 6.4% 10.2% 3.9% Saint Vincent and the Grenadines
1980s 6.9% 10.9% 3.9% Saint Vincent and the Grenadines
1990s 8.2% 11.2% 3.0% Saint Vincent and the Grenadines
2000s 9.6% 11.9% 2.3% Saint Vincent and the Grenadines
2010s 12.6% 14.2% 1.6% Saint Vincent and the Grenadines
2020s 16.1% 16.7% 0.6% Saint Vincent and the Grenadines

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
